We are seeking a Master Data Analyst with demonstrated experience in data analytics to work as a key member of the Data Management team. This analyst will support teams working in Agile (Sprint) as well as traditional Waterfall methodologies for Software Development Lifecycle (SDLC).
Responsibilities include analyzing problems; documenting business processes and data lifecycle; developing data requirements, user stories and acceptance criteria; and testing. We are a fast-paced organization with very high standards for work quality and efficiency. This position is expected to handle multiple projects, and remain flexible and productive, despite changing priorities and processes. Ongoing improvement and efficiency are a part of our culture, and each team member is expected to proactively contribute to process improvements.
Responsibilities:
Work with the Project team members and business stakeholders to understand business processes and data flows
Develop expertise in the customersβ datasets and data lifecycle
Profile source data; review source data and compare content and structure to dataset requirements; identify conflicts and determine recommendations for resolution
Conduct entity resolution to identify matching and merging and semantic conflicts
Conduct data attribute mapping back to the data source
Elicit, record, and manage metadata
Diagram current processes and proposed modifications using process flows, context diagrams and data flow diagrams
Discover and document requirements and user stories with a focus on improving both business and technical processing
Decompose requirements into Epics and Features and create clear and concise user stories that are easy to understand and implement by technical staff
Utilize progressive elaboration; map stories to data models and architectures to be used by internal staff to facilitate master data management
Identify and group related user stories into themes, document dependencies and associated business processes
Assist Product Owner in maintaining the product backlog
Create conceptual prototypes and mock-ups
Collaborate with staff, vendors, consultants, and contractors as they are engaged on tasks to formulate, detail and test potential and implemented solutions
Coordinate and Facilitate User Acceptance Testing with Business and ensure Project Managers/Scrum Masters are informed of the progress
Qualifications
Required:
The candidate must have a minimum of 10 years of experience delivering business data analysis artifacts
5+ years of experience as an Agile Business Analyst; strong understanding of Scrum concepts and methodology
5+ year of experience writing complex queries to analyze data
Experience translating client and product strategy requirements into dataset requirements and user stories
Proficient with defining acceptance criteria and managing acceptance process
Experience with enterprise data management
Expertise with Microsoft Office products (Word, Excel, Access, Outlook, Visio, PowerPoint, Project Server)
The candidate must have exceptional written and oral communications skills and have the proven ability to work well with a diverse set of peers and customers
Preferred:
Certified Data Management Professional (CDMP)
Experience using Team Foundation Server and work item tracking
Experience with automated testing tools such as Test Complete
